65 Delayed-Payment Cases Worth Rs 8.29 Crore Resolved At Telangana's Parishrama Adalat
Hyderabad, Aug. 25 -- The 'Parishrama Adalat', a conciliation conclave for delayed-payment disputes involving micro and small enterprises (MSEs), has resolved 65 cases involving Rs 8.29 crore, the Telangana government said.
Organised by the Commissionerate of Industries and Commerce, Telangana, in association with the Ministry of MSME, the conclave was held at FTCCI in Hyderabad. It brought together MSEs, buyers, public sector enterprises, MSE Facilitation Councils, alternative dispute resolution institutions and government officials.
